Xtant Medical names new chief officer: 4 highlights

Xtant Medical appointed Kevin Brandt as chief commercial officer, effective July 9.

Advertisement

Here are four highlights:

1. Mr. Brandt brings more than 28 years of medical device industry experience into his new role.

2. He formerly served as executive president and CCO for RTI Surgical’s domestic direct business.

3. Prior to working at RTI Surgical, Mr. Brant spent 18 years with Stryker.

4. At Stryker, Mr. Brandt served in various leadership positions, including president of osteokinetics for 10 years.

“We are excited to have such a talented and experienced executive officer join our team,” said Carl O’Connell, CEO of Xtant. “[Mr. Brandt’s] past accomplishments in the medical device industry show that he is an accomplished business strategist with a unique ability to provide the leadership in sales and marketing to build our Company’s revenues and profitability. I expect his contributions will be transformative for Xtant.”
